Open Carry Gun Owner Has Gun Stolen From Behind

By Jacob Paulsen / April 5, 2022

I think there is one man in Phoenix that will be carrying concealed from now on. While standing in line at a local McDonalds, a man who was open carrying his handgun was approached from behind by the suspect who proceeded to draw the firearm and flee out of the restaurant.
